Honda CR-V eFCEV
The 2026 Honda CR-V e:FCEV redefines the plug-in hybrid by replacing the traditional gasoline engine with an advanced hydrogen fuel cell system. This innovative powertrain utilizes a 174-horsepower electric motor fueled by two distinct sources: a rechargeable battery providing 29 miles of localized EV range and a hydrogen tank offering an estimated 241 miles for longer treks. By combining these technologies, the CR-V e:FCEV delivers a versatile total driving range of approximately 270 miles while remaining entirely free of tailpipe emissions.
Offered in only one trim for this year but it comes fully loaded with a power liftgate, heated side mirrors with integrated turn signals, LED headlights and daytime running, 18-inch wheels, auto-dimming rearview mirror, heated front seats, driver seat memory, ambient interior lighting, automatic dual-zone climate control, HD satellite radio with a 12-speaker Bose sound system, 9-inch touchscreen, voice activated navigation, adaptive cruise control with traffic stop-go, mobile hotspot, wireless device charging, 4 USB ports, 10.2-inch gauge cluster, and a heated steering wheel.
Safety features are abundant with 10 airbags, front and rear parking sensors, active lane departure, blind spot warning, forward and rear collision mitigation, front pedestrian detection, a driver attention alert, and a traffic sign information system.
